Lines Matching defs:hostname
33 #include "hostname-util.h"
57 char *hostname;
78 printf(" Static hostname: %s\n", strna(i->static_hostname));
82 printf(" Pretty hostname: %s\n", i->pretty_hostname);
84 if (!isempty(i->hostname) &&
85 !streq_ptr(i->hostname, i->static_hostname))
86 printf("Transient hostname: %s\n", i->hostname);
158 { "Hostname", "s", NULL, offsetof(StatusInfo, hostname) },
197 free(info.hostname);
254 char *hostname = args[1];
266 /* If the passed hostname is already valid, then
268 * hostnames, so let's unset the pretty hostname, and
269 * just set the passed hostname as static/dynamic
270 * hostname. */
272 if (arg_static && hostname_is_valid(hostname, true)) {
275 hostname = hostname_cleanup(hostname);
277 p = h = strdup(hostname);
281 hostname_cleanup(hostname);
290 r = set_simple_string(bus, "SetStaticHostname", hostname);
296 r = set_simple_string(bus, "SetHostname", hostname);
334 "Query or change system hostname.\n\n"
340 " --transient Only set transient hostname\n"
341 " --static Only set static hostname\n"
342 " --pretty Only set pretty hostname\n\n"
344 " status Show current hostname settings\n"
345 " set-hostname NAME Set system hostname\n"
440 { "set-hostname", EQUAL, 2, set_hostname },